Ophthalmology Drugs and Devices Market Overview
Ophthalmology drugs and devices encompasses pharmaceutical products and medical technologies used to diagnose, treat and manage eye disorders like cataract, glaucoma, macular degeneration and diabetic retinopathy. Market includes surgical tools, diagnostic equipment and prescription drugs tailored to preserve and restore vision. Growth has been driven by rising prevalence of age related eye diseases and increased adoption of minimally invasive surgical techniques and gene based therapy. Demand is increasing by globally aging population and expanding access to healthcare, while supply is supported by continuous innovation in biologics, laser based system and AI integrated diagnostics.
North America led the market in 2025, due to its advanced healthcare infrastructure and high awareness. Europe, benefits from strong reimbursement system and increasing diabetic retinopathy cases. Key players like Alcon, Johnson & Johnson Vision Care and Novartis dominate through innovation, global reach and strategic investment in gene therapies. Ophthalmology Drugs and Devices Market Segmentation
Based on Surgical Devices segment, the market of the ophthalmology market comprises tools and instruments used in various eye surgeries to treat vision disorders and improve ocular health. Cataract surgery devices are widely used to remove clouded lenses and implant intraocular lenses, especially in elderly patients. Ophthalmic viscoelastic devices (OVDs) play a crucial role during surgeries by protecting sensitive eye tissues and maintaining space within the eye. For patients with glaucoma, glaucoma surgery devices help reduce intraocular pressure by enhancing fluid drainage. Refractive surgery devices, such as those used in LASIK and other corrective procedures, aim to reshape the cornea and reduce dependence on glasses or contact lenses. This segment also includes other surgical instruments used in procedures like retinal repair or eyelid correction, contributing to better surgical efficiency and patient outcomes.
Based on Diagnostic and Monitoring Equipment segment, the market focuses on detection and ongoing management of eye conditions using advanced imaging and examination tools. Optical coherence tomography (OCT) is a key technology that captures cross sectional images of the retina, helping detect diseases like macular degeneration and diabetic retinopathy. Fundus cameras are commonly used in clinical settings to photograph the retina for diagnosis and monitoring. Ophthalmic ultrasound imaging systems are beneficial for viewing internal structures of the eye, especially when the lens is opaque or in cases of trauma. Ophthalmoscopes remain a fundamental tool for eye doctors to inspect the retina and optic nerve directly. Additionally, other diagnostic tools such as visual field analyzers and tonometers support comprehensive eye exams, particularly in identifying glaucoma and other progressive conditions.
Ophthalmology Drugs and Devices Market Regional Analysis
North America dominated the global ophthalmology drugs and devices market in 2025. This leadership is driven by several key factors, including the presence of advanced healthcare infrastructure, high adoption of cutting edge technologies, and a strong focus on research and development. The region benefits from a growing elderly population, which is more susceptible to eye disorders like cataracts, glaucoma, and macular degeneration. Favorable reimbursement policies and the high awareness of eye health among the population further boost market demand. The U.S., in particular, is home to major medical device manufacturers and pharmaceutical companies investing in ophthalmic innovations. Government support for clinical trials and faster regulatory approvals by the FDA also contribute to early product adoption. Moreover, the increasing prevalence of diabetes, a key risk factor for several eye diseases, supports sustained market growth. Overall, North America's strong economic base and healthcare access make it a leading force in this sector.
Ophthalmology Drugs and Devices Market Competitive Landscape
Alcon Inc., Johnson & Johnson Vision Care and Novartis AG collectively leads global ophthalmology drugs and devices market, leveraging deep portfolio, global reach and sustained innovation. Alcon, operating as standalone eye care leader post its spin off from Novartis, maintains a dominant position across both surgical and vision care segment. Robust pipeline of intraocular lense, cataract surgery platform and diagnostics is complemented by strong global commercial footprint in North America and emerging markets. Johnson & Johnson Vision Care a division of strategically integrate pharmaceutical and device enables it to deliver end to end solutions for refractive error and ocular surface disease. Companys emphasis on innovation in contact lenses and laser correction system provide strong competitive differentiation. Novartis AG, is more pharma focused post its divestment of Alcon, remains key innovator in ophthalmic drugs, notably through its blockbuster products like Lucentis and Beovu. Continued investment in gene therapies and biosimilars signals forward looking strategy aimed at high burden retinal disease.
Ophthalmology Drugs and Devices Market Trends
| Trends | Details | Impact on Market |
| Rise in Minimally Invasive & Laser-based Procedures | Adoption of femtosecond lasers, micro-incision cataract surgery, and minimally invasive glaucoma surgery (MIGS) is increasing due to faster recovery and improved outcomes. | Boosts demand for advanced ophthalmic devices and drives innovation in surgical tools. |
| Growth in Biologic and Gene Therapies | Novel drug classes such as anti-VEGF biologics (e.g., aflibercept) and gene therapies (e.g., Luxturna for inherited retinal disease) are gaining traction. | Expands the treatment landscape for previously untreatable conditions, encouraging R&D investment. |
| Integration of AI and Teleophthalmology | AI-powered diagnostic tools and remote screening platforms are improving early detection and management of eye diseases. | Increases accessibility and efficiency, particularly in underserved and rural populations. |
Ophthalmology Drugs and Devices Market Recent Developments
| Date | Company | Development | Impact |
|---|---|---|---|
| 03 September 2025 | Alcon | Completed the strategic acquisition of LumiThera, Inc., gaining full global commercialization rights to the Valeda Photobiomodulation (PBM) System. | Expands the company's footprint into non-invasive clinical retina care for early and intermediate dry age-related macular degeneration (AMD). |
| 09 October 2025 | Celltrion | Secured U.S. FDA clearance for EYDENZELT (aflibercept-boav), an interchangeable ophthalmic biosimilar referencing EYLEA. | Broadens affordable biologic access for patients suffering from neovascular (wet) AMD and retinal vascular disorders. |
| 10 November 2025 | MeiraGTx | Entered into a major global collaboration with Eli Lilly and Company to develop genetic medicines in ophthalmology. | Accelerates commercialization of AAV-AIPL1 gene therapy for severe inherited retinal dystrophies such as Leber congenital amaurosis 4. |
| 01 July 2026 | Samsung Bioepis | Partnered with Harrow to relaunch BYOOVIZ (ranibizumab-nuna) across the United States commercial supply network. | Strengthens distribution scale and clinical adoption of cost-effective anti-VEGF biosimilars for wet AMD and macular edema. |
| 08 July 2026 | Tarsus Pharmaceuticals | Acquired clinical-stage ophthalmic biopharmaceutical firm iRenix Medical, Inc. and its late-stage asset IRX-101. | Enhances the portfolio with an investigational ocular antiseptic engineered to minimize post-procedural pain and corneal toxicity during intravitreal injections. |
